Career Path
The Global Certificate in Public Sector Data Confidentiality is designed to equip professionals with the latest skills and knowledge required for managing sensitive data within the public sector. This course focuses on crucial aspects of data handling, including privacy, security, and ethical considerations. In this section, we present a 3D pie chart to highlight the current job market trends in the UK for roles related to public sector data confidentiality.
As a Data Analyst in the public sector, you can expect to work with large datasets, conducting statistical analysis, and creating data visualizations to inform policy decisions. The demand for professionals with these skills remains high, with a 45% share in the job market.
Data Engineers are responsible for building and maintaining the infrastructure that securely stores and processes sensitive data in the public sector. With a 30% share in the job market, data engineers play a critical role in ensuring the confidentiality and integrity of public sector data.
Data Scientists in the public sector leverage advanced analytical techniques to derive insights, predict trends, and inform decision-making. With a 25% share in the job market, data scientists contribute significantly to the development of evidence-based policies and strategies.
The UK public sector offers attractive salary ranges for these roles, with data analysts typically earning between £25,000 and £40,000, data engineers between £30,000 and £60,000, and data scientists between £35,000 and £80,000.
